Dangote Cement: Protest In Lagos In Reaction To Massive Sack Of Trcuk Officers by delxmaverick(m): 4:02pm On Feb 23, 2017
Following the sack of all Truck Officers by Dangote cement earlier this month, sacked officers have taken to the streets of Lagos, targeting the head office (Marble House) to protest the use-and-dump idea of Dangote Cement Company.
